What is the New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ist?

The New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ist serves as an essential tool for applicants seeking to amend their building consents. This checklist is significant in the amendment process as it ensures that all required information is submitted accurately, aligning with the original building consent and adhering to the New Zealand Building Code (NZBC). By utilizing this checklist, applicants streamline their application process and enhance compliance, making it a vital resource for any building amendment endeavor.

Who Needs the New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ist?

The New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ist is required by a variety of individuals and entities involved in building projects. Homeowners, builders, and property developers are among those who must submit this checklist when seeking amendments. Situations that necessitate the checklist include changes to the original building plans, modifications to specifications, or any alterations that impact compliance with the NZBC.

Submission Methods and Requirements for the New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ist

Once completed, the New Zealand Building Consent Amendment Checklist can be submitted through various methods, including online platforms or traditional mail. Submission requirements may involve:
  • Accompanying documents such as original consent plans.
  • Payment of any fees associated with the amendment process.
It is crucial to verify the submission method and any specific documents required before sending the checklist to ensure compliance with local regulations.
